Ensuring Transparency and Integrity in Lobbying

 

International Seminar

Moscow, Russia 

8 June 2012


In seeking greater transparency in lobbying, Russia is hosting this international seminar which will highlight how different countries are using regulation to ensure transparency and integrity in lobbying. 

 

This meeting is organised by the Ministry of Economic Development of Russia, the OECD and the UN Office on Drugs and Crime and will feature presentations and keynote remarks from the Administration of the President of the Russian Federation, representatives from the Privy Council Office of Canada and the United States Department of Justice, Russian NGO, business and trade union representatives.

 

The meeting will highlight the key requirements of a high-quality lobbying framework in accordance with the OECD Principles on Transparency and Integrity in Lobbying and will cover:

 

  • the risks associated with lobbying
  • international country experience in the legal regulation of lobbying (Canada & USA)
  • assessment of the current situation
  • future steps for ensuring transparency and integrity in lobbying

 

The meeting aims to facilitate dialogue and exchange amongst Russian stakeholders.
